August review: It ain’t over ‘til it’s over

Insights16:05, September 18, 2025
insight picture

Horacio Coutino, multi-asset strategist

“I think the economy is weakening. Whether it’s on the way to recession or just weakening, I don’t know.”
— Jamie Dimon, CEO of JPMorgan in an interview with CNBC, on 9th September, 2025.

A strong earnings season gave way to higher US equity valuations and heightened earnings growth for US equities. Nevertheless, investor concerns regarding institutional erosion, stemming from the White House's push for greater influence over monetary policy, were evident in the steepening US yield curve throughout August.

Our analysis provides an in-depth examination of the current trends and future outlook for US equities, with a particular focus on the impact of a weakening US dollar. The analysis highlights the potential benefits for EM equities, which have shown strong performance despite global trade headwinds.

Additionally, we explore the sector-specific impacts of dollar depreciation on US firms, noting that while some sectors may benefit from increased global competitiveness, others may face challenges due to rising input costs. These results underscore the importance of understanding the complex dynamics of global value chains and the varying effects on different industries.
